Property Owner Resources & NO On CA Prop 33 | Guest: AOA USA’s Jeff Faller | Episode 316

California homeowners, perhaps you have heard of The Justice For Renters Act. It is an initiative appearing on the November ballot this year to pave the way for state-wide rent control ordinances.

On this episode, I am joined the Apartment Owners Association President Jeff Faller. We discuss The Justice For Renters Act, aka Proposition 33, and how Associations like his provide vital resources for landlords.
